Ship profile for the sailing ship: "Havet"
Technical data of the sailing ship:
Name: | Havet |
Ex-names: | Edvord Hansen |
Registered port: | Helsingør |
Nation: | DK |
Type of rigging: | KETSCH |
Type of ship: | Galeasse |
Year built: | 1953 |
Yard: | Holbæk Skibs- & Bådebuggeri, Holbæk, DK |
Overall length: | 37.50 m |
Length (hull): | 29.20 m |
Breadth: | 7.04 m |
Draught: | 2.60 m |
Sail area: | 480 m2 |
Ship's hull: | Holz / Wood |
Power: | 380 PS |
Engine: | Mercedes OM 424 A |
Portrait of the sailing ship:
Last update: 27 Jul 2000
- built in 1953, her first name was "Edvord Hansen", designated for voyages to Greenland, she carried cargo goods, grain and feed-stuff between Copenhagen and the island Bornholm
- 1972 purchased by the City of Copenhagen, renamed to "Havet" ("The sea"), converted to sail with passengers
- general overhaul in Marstal/DK in 1991
